Phoenix searches for new city manager


Phoenix, Ore. — The City of Phoenix will be without a city manager for at least another week.

Former Ashland city administrator Dave Kanner was invited to Monday night’s meeting by Mayor Chris Luz as a potential interim city manager.

The council decided not to appoint an interim and to instead wait until the next council meeting where they could hear public comment and to allow time for residents to apply.

“I want to do our due diligence and our first accountability is to the public. And I want to make sure that if they have something to say that they’re included in this process before we make a decision,” stated councilor Sarah Westover.

The incoming manager will have their work cut out for them, only having a few weeks to help prepare the budget.

The next council meeting will take place on March 20th.
